Question
which equation choice could represent the graph shown below? answer f(x) = (x + 7)(x - 4)(x + 5) f(x) = (x + 7)(x + 4)(x - 5) f(x) = (x + 7)(x - 4)(x - 5) f(x) = (x - 7)(x - 4)(x + 5)
Step1: Identify x - intercepts
From the graph, the curve crosses the x - axis at \( x=-7 \), \( x = 4 \), and \( x=5 \).
Step2: Write the factored form
If a polynomial has roots \( r_1\), \( r_2\), \( r_3\), then its factored form is \( f(x)=a(x - r_1)(x - r_2)(x - r_3) \) (assuming \( a = 1 \) for simplicity here). For roots \( x=-7\) (which is \( x-(-7)=x + 7\)), \( x = 4\) (which is \( x-4\)), and \( x = 5\) (which is \( x - 5\)), the polynomial is \( f(x)=(x + 7)(x - 4)(x - 5) \).
